Intra-site configuration The intra-site configuration is the lowest-cost configuration of all three
configurations. It is used in environments where a long-distance fabric is not
required because of the close proximity of the hosts and storage arrays.
Because the intra-site configuration only has two switches, it is similar to
the campus configuration. However, multiple-switch fabrics do not exist in
this configuration.
The configuration is redundant for host bus adapters, controllers,
Synchronous Mirroring ports, and switches but is a single point of failure
for the site because all of the equipment can be destroyed by the same
disaster.
The highest availability campus configuration is the recommended
configuration, because it is fully redundant, which makes disaster recovery
easier.
